Before you can build, grade, fence, or farm a piece of Northwest Arkansas ground, it often has to be cleared — and the wooded, brushy lots common across Benton County can be a real job. We clear and grub land of all sizes, from a single overgrown residential lot to acreage out toward Gravette, Decatur, and Garfield. We take down brush and unwanted trees, grind or pull stumps, grub out roots, and haul off or pile and burn the debris, leaving clean, workable ground. A lot of our clearing is the first step in a bigger project — site prep for a new home, a pad for a barn or shop, a pasture, a building site on raw acreage, or opening up a view — so we clear with the next step in mind, taking the lot down to the grade and condition the project actually needs. We work around the trees you want to keep and clear out the rest.

Common Site & Drainage Issues in Lowell
The dirt-work and drainage problems we see most around here — and how we handle them.
Commercial and industrial site work
Lowell’s position on the I-49 corridor draws a lot of commercial and industrial construction, which needs heavy site prep — clearing, large cut and fill, compacted pads, and roughed-in drainage and access. We do that work on a contractor’s schedule and coordinate so the project keeps moving.
Drainage where building changed the runoff
Steady construction in and around Lowell has changed how water moves across a lot of properties, leaving some yards and lots taking on runoff they never did. We diagnose where the water now comes from and intercept and redirect it with grading and drainage to a safe outlet.
Mixed flat and rolling ground
Lowell has flatter ground near the corridor and rolling Ozark soil away from it, and each drains differently. Flat ground ponds without proper slope; rolling ground sheds runoff fast. We grade and drain each for what it is so the finished site handles water the right way.
